The light bulb sign in pheochromocytoma

Pheochromocytomas are the most common tumors arising from the adrenal medulla. Although preoperative diagnosis can be straightforward with biochemical testing [1], imaging is useful for lesion location and staging as 10% can be extra-adrenal, and 10% malignant [13]. …
